Computer Life
Living in the dorms thru the school them WiFi is hardly available. Living at Naismith then there is WiFi which, is poor for the entire Lawrence area. The television cable channels at Naismith are awful and they take away all of the channels that this age group typically watches. Definite need for a personal laptop. You do get $8 worth of printing through the school from your tuition.

Student Life
There are plenty of ways to spend time off campus in Lawrence. That's one of the benefits for going to KU. Massachusetts street is very popular with shopping and quaint restaurants. If needed, Target is 2 miles down the road on Iowa street. On Mass St. then you can get noodles & co, chipotle, buffalo wild wings and many delicious restaurants. There are many delivery services to the dorm which definitely is nice. Most of them run until 3 AM!
